Write repeated multiplication using exponent notation

Repeated multiplication of the same factor is represented compactly by a power: the base identifies the repeated factor, and the whole-number exponent counts how many times it is used as a factor, as in 5×5×5=535 \times 5 \times 5=5^3. The notation preserves the distinction between the base and exponent, including parentheses for negative bases; negative and fractional exponents, and more advanced exponent laws, are not included.

Detailed Explanation: Write repeated multiplication using exponent notation

When the same factor is multiplied by itself repeatedly, write it as a power:

  • The repeated factor is the base.
  • The number of times it appears is the exponent.

Example

Rewrite:

(2)×(2)×(2)(-2)\times(-2)\times(-2)

Step 1: Identify the repeated factor.
The factor being repeated is 2-2, so the base is (2)(-2).

Step 2: Count how many times it appears.
There are three factors of 2-2, so the exponent is 33.

Step 3: Write the power.

(2)×(2)×(2)=(2)3(-2)\times(-2)\times(-2)=(-2)^3

The parentheses show that the entire number 2-2 is the base.
